WALTER W. TAYLOR IS DEAD

Was a Brother of Mrs. T. .T. McCoy Formerly of Rensselaer. Mrs. Henry A. Taylor of South Ninth street received a telegram yesterday announcing the sudden death of Walter W. Taylor, for many years a resident of Lafayette. Death occurred Tuesday in New York city, but the particulars were not given. Mb. Taylor was a son of the late Major and Mrs. William Taylor and was about 60 years old. He was born in Lafayette and left here about thirty years ago, going to Redfield, South Dakota. For a number of years he had oeen engaged in selling irrigated lands in the West. He lived the past year at Glenwood, Illinois. For a number of years he resided in Chicago. Besides the widow he leaves a sister, Mrs. T. J. McCoy, of Grand Rapids, Michigan.— Lafayette Journal.
